Diagnosing Thyroid Conditions



The endocrinologist's know-how reaches accurately diagnosing thyroid conditions via a detailed analysis, consisting of a detailed case history, checkup, and specialized examinations (Best endocrinologist in austin). This strategy allows the endocrinologist to collect critical details about the individual's signs, medical background, and family members history, which can offer beneficial insights into the potential reasons for the thyroid condition


During the physical exam, the endocrinologist will meticulously examine the individual's neck for any signs of swelling or abnormality in the thyroid gland. They might likewise check for various other physical indicators, such as adjustments in hair appearance, skin dryness, or sticking out eyes, which can be a measure of thyroid conditions.




Along with the case history and physical evaluation, the endocrinologist may order specific tests to additional examine the function of the thyroid gland. These examinations may include blood examinations to measure the degrees of thyroid hormonal agents, th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H), and antibodies that might be connected with autoimmune thyroid disorders. Imaging tests, such as ultrasound or nuclear medication scans, might additionally be executed to evaluate the dimension, form, and structure of the thyroid gland.

Long-Term Care and Assistance





Lasting treatment and support for people with thyroid problems includes recurring surveillance and customized therapy prepares given by an endocrinologist. After a first diagnosis and treatment, it is crucial for clients to continue getting normal follow-up treatment to guarantee that their thyroid function continues to be secure and that any type of prospective difficulties are recognized and addressed immediately.


Routine tracking of thyroid hormone degrees via blood tests permits the endocrinologist to examine the performance of the treatment plan and make any type of necessary changes. This close tracking likewise makes it possible for the early detection of any type of changes in thyroid function and the recognition of possible relapses or difficulties, such as the growth of blemishes or the progression of thyroid cancer cells. Relying on the details requirements of the patient, monitoring may occur every few months or on a yearly basis.
